Beauty fulfillment capabilities
- Several FDA-registered facilities across our network: appropriate for cosmetics, skincare, personal care, wellness products
- OTC-compliant facilities in Denver, Atlanta, and New Jersey
- Temperature-controlled storage in Atlanta, Dallas, and Los Angeles for heat-sensitive formulations
- Glass, liquid, and fragile product handling protocols built into picking and packing workflows to avoid the potential for damaged products
- Custom dunnage, protective packaging, and dimensional packaging to reduce transit damage
- Damage rate monitoring and carrier accountability for fragile SKU performance, ensuring that more packages reach their destination without issue
- Full lot number and expiration date capture at receiving for traceability and compliance without needing manual tracking
- FEFO pick logic: Prioritizes eligible inventory with the earliest expiration date, helping reduce near-expiry inventory and support client-defined shelf-life requirements
- Recall readiness: Lot-distribution reports are available for configured programs based on lot and shipment data captured in the WMS
- Consultative and customized automation approach that identifies the highest-impact opportunities for your specific SKU profile and order patterns
- Purpose-built automation: AMRs, conveyor systems, and pick-to-light, that reduces labor dependency while improving pick accuracy and throughput
- QuickBox offers a proprietary smart waving algorithm that auto batches units and orders more efficiently
- For one brand, this auto-batching tool (ABT) lifted throughput from 300 units per hour (with the brand’s previous 3PL) to 900 – 1200 units per hour. These gains supported 3x order-volume growth.
Why beauty brands choose QuickBox for fulfillment
Beauty fulfillment has unique operational demands: fragile products that require careful handling, temperature-sensitive formulations, lot and expiration date tracking for regulatory compliance, and a consumer expectation for premium unboxing that doesn't tolerate damage or mispicks. Scaling into Sephora, Ulta, or Target adds a new layer: routing guide compliance, EDI integration, and retail workflows designed to reduce chargeback risk.
